POLICE have found a man who sparked a missing person alert when he walked out of a hospital without being discharged by a doctor.

Officers on the ground and the South Wales Police helicopter had been involved in the search for the man on Thursday.

There were concerns for his welfare.

But the search was called off later that night when the man was found safe and well.

It is understood the man left Swansea's Morriston Hospital after going outside to have a cigarette.

An Abertawe Bro Morgannwg University Health Board spokeswoman said because the man left Morriston Hospital before he was discharged by a doctor they told both security and the police.

A South Wales Police spokesman said: "The man missing from the Morriston area on Thursday was found safe and well that night."

An Abertawe Bro Morgannwg University Health Board spokeswoman added: "We can confirm a patient left one of our hospitals of their own free will on Wednesday.

"Because the patient left before being discharged by a doctor we informed security and the police. "This is completely normal as it is important to locate the patient and carry out a welfare check."
